Hi Herbert,
I could not reproduce this here (Ubuntu 10.04 host, Putty on Windows 7).
I have no experience with viper-mode and only know very basic vi
commands. When viper-mode asked me for a user level, I specified 5.
Org-mode version 6.36trans (release_6.36.52.geec2)
Visibility cycling with TAB works both in command and insert mode.
I can also access the agenda using C-c a a.
Looks like putty is misconfigured. While quickly scanning through
putty's configuration menu, the only setting I noticed was "Connection
-> Data -> Terminal-type string", which is set to "xterm" here.
However, I did not modify the default values, so it should work out of
the box.
You can try logging in with putty, executing "sleep 5", and interrupting
that with C-c. If that does not work, the problem is definitely not
emacs related.
